Book Synopsis

Hollyhock center chefs celebrate thirty years of exquisite meals on Canada's Cortes Island with more than two hundred sustainable, garden-fresh recipes.

World renowned as an unparalleled center of learning and connection, Hollyhock exists to inspire, nourish and support people who are making the world better. At the heart of this unique institution, located on beautiful Cortes Island, is Hollyhock''s spectacular organic garden, just steps away from the ocean view kitchen. Following their popular Hollyhock Cooks, Moreka Jolar and Heidi Scheifley offer more than 200 new garden-inspired recipes.

Hollyhock: Garden to Table invites you to enjoy the beauty of fresh, local food. The book is filled with imaginative ideas, global inspiration, and invaluable growing tips from Hollyhock''s own Master Gardener, Nori Fletcher.
